Tom M. Apostol's "Calculus, Volume 2: Multi-variable Calculus, Linear Algebra" is a widely used textbook in calculus courses, particularly in the second semester of a two-semester sequence. The book covers topics such as multivariable calculus, differential equations, and linear algebra. The Core Difficulties:

  1. Theoretical Linear Algebra: Chapter 1 introduces vector spaces, linear independence, and inner products with a level of abstraction rarely seen in a calculus course. Proofs about the existence of bases or the properties of determinants are standard exercises.
  2. Topology of $\mathbbR^n$: Open sets, closed sets, limit points, and compactness – concepts usually reserved for real analysis – appear early. Without a manual, verifying a proof about the Heine-Borel theorem is daunting.
  3. Differential Calculus in $\mathbbR^n$: Apostol defines the derivative as a linear transformation (a Jacobian matrix). Exercises often ask you to prove the chain rule from this definition or show that differentiability implies continuity.
  4. Line and Surface Integrals: The final chapters cover Green’s, Stokes’, and Gauss’ theorems. Computations become algebraic nightmares, and the proofs require a masterful use of vector identities.
